So, what *is* personal branding, really? At its core, personal branding is the conscious effort to define and promote what makes you unique and valuable in your professional sphere. It's about taking control of your narrative rather than letting others define it for you. This isn't just for entrepreneurs or celebrities; every professional, from the junior analyst to the seasoned CEO, benefits from a clear and compelling personal brand. It helps you to:
- Stand out in a crowded market: Differentiate yourself from competitors.
- Build trust and credibility: Position yourself as an authority in your niche.
- Attract ideal opportunities: Align your aspirations with relevant projects and roles.
- Increase your influence: Become a go-to resource for others.
It's the strategic art of making yourself indispensable.
Understanding and applying personal branding principles is no longer optional; it's a vital component of modern career success.

**From Follower to Frontier: Navigating the Digital Wild West with Elyas's Strategic Toolkit (Practical Tips, Common Questions: "How do I even start building an audience?" "Is it too late to get into this?")**
Embarking on the journey to build an audience in today's vast digital landscape can feel like stepping into an untamed frontier. Many aspiring content creators echo the question,
"How do I even start building an audience?"The key, as Elyas emphasizes, lies in a strategic blend of authenticity and consistent value. Forget blanket approaches; instead, focus on identifying your niche and target audience with precision. What unique perspective or solution do you offer? Begin by creating content that genuinely addresses their pain points or curiosities, utilizing platforms where they already congregate. Don't underestimate the power of engaging with your early viewers, responding to comments, and fostering a sense of community. This isn't just about broadcasting; it's about building relationships, one valuable interaction at a time.
The notion that it might be
"too late to get into this"is a common misconception that often stifles potential. The digital wild west is constantly evolving, presenting new opportunities for those willing to adapt and innovate. While established voices exist, the beauty of this frontier is its sheer size and the continuous emergence of new topics, platforms, and communities. Rather than viewing late entry as a disadvantage, see it as an opportunity to learn from existing successes and failures. Focus on carving out your unique space, perhaps by combining existing ideas in novel ways or by addressing underserved niches. The most successful pioneers are not always the first, but those who are persistent, adaptable, and genuinely committed to providing value to their audience. Start small, stay consistent, and let your authentic voice guide your journey.
